Mediante Ley No. 4463 del 2 de junio de 1956fue consagrada comoPanteón de la Patriapara acoger en un ambiente religioso, de amor yveneración, los restos de las figuras que han merecidoel reconocimiento eterno de la República¡Gloria a nuestros hombres y mujeres ilustres!16 de agosto de 2014English translation:Ministry of Culture Temple of St. Ignatius LoyolaChurch of the Company of Jesus(Jesuits) Its construction was finished around 1745 for use as a temple and as the main classroom of the Royal and Pontifical University of Santiago de la Paz (1745-1767). From 1792-1798 it was the chapel of the Royal Seminary and Conciliar de San Fernando. On June 2, 1956 the Law No. 4463 consecrated it as the Pantheon of the Nationwhere the remains of those who have earned the eternal recognition of the Republic can be kept in a religious environment of love and veneration. Glory to our illustrious men and women! August 16, 2014
